首頁 > web前端 > 前端問答 > 前端頁面由哪三大層次構成

前端頁面由哪三大層次構成

青灯夜游
發布: 2021-10-28 14:02:42
原創
8935 人瀏覽過

前端頁面由「結構層」、「表示層」、「行為層」三大層構成。結構層為頁面的骨架,由HTML創建,用於搭建文件的結構;表示層為頁面的樣式,由CSS創建,用於設定文件的呈現效果;行為層為頁面的行為,由JavaScript創建,用於實現文檔的行為。

前端頁面由哪三大層次構成

本教學操作環境:windows7系統、CSS3&&HTML5&&javascript1.8.5版、Dell G3電腦。

前端頁面構成的三層即結構層、表示層、行為層。

  • 結構層為頁面的骨架,由 HTML 或 XHTML 標記語言創建,用於建立文件的結構。

    HTML 用來定義網頁的內容,例如標題、內文、圖片等;

  • #表示層為頁面的樣式,由CSS (層疊樣式表)負責創建,用於設定文件的呈現效果。

    CSS 用來控制網頁的外觀,例如顏色、字體、背景等;

  • #行為層為頁面的行為,由JavaScript 語言創建,用於實現文件的行為。

    JavaScript 用來即時更新網頁中的內容,例如從伺服器取得資料並更新到網頁中,修改某些標籤的樣式或其中的內容等,可以讓網頁更生動。

不過,這三種技術之間存在著一些潛在的重疊區域,如:DOM 技術可以用來改變網頁的結構。在 CSS 身上也可以找到這種技巧相互重疊的例子。諸如 :hover 和 :focus 之類的預定義符號(偽 class 屬性) 讓我們可以根據使用者觸發事件來改變呈現效果。改變元素的呈現效果當然是表示層的“勢力範圍”,但對使用者觸發事件做出反應卻是行為層的領地。表示層和行為層 的這種重疊形成了一個灰色地帶。

更多程式相關知識,請造訪:程式設計學習! !

以上是前端頁面由哪三大層次構成的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板